Transaction 572fb908c1ba2bfb060fdc3f91b8ab78e1cea524d9c5e01185b6cf2d92880579
1 Input
1 Output
-
572fb908c1ba2bfb060fdc3f91b8ab78e1cea524d9c5e01185b6cf2d92880579:0
- value
- 33701748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d667443f2b593d64dcfa4234c38253045fce24e6 OP_EQUAL
- address
- 3MEgEgciTuqhvPsXQN5kX4pvBmfg6sKDhH